Drone footage shows the horrifying aftermath of a collapsed nightclub that killed dozens in the Dominican Republic.

The roof of Jet Set Club caved in during a concert attended by politicians, athletes, and other prominent personalities in Santo Domingo in the early hours of April 8.

Video captured the shattered remains of the Jet Set Club building with concrete debris and mangled roof panels scattered everywhere in Santo Domingo.

Firefighters used flashlights to navigate through the wreckage, searching for survivors in the darkness.

Ambulance and rescue vehicles as 79 revellers were killed, and another 220 people were injured.

Former Major League Baseball pitcher Octavio Dotel was among the victims. Dotel reportedly died on the way to the hospital after being pulled from the rubble.

Firemen deployed heavy equipment to search for potential survivors in the debris.

Juan Manuel Mendez, director of the Center for Emergency Operations, said: 'We continue clearing debris and searching for people. We're going to search tirelessly for people.'

Officials reported that 22 public institutions are at the site to assist with the rescue efforts.

The cause of the incident remains under investigation.
